What are some typical challenges imaging service engineers face when maintaining complex medical imaging equipment?

Imaging Service Engineers often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ting highly technical issues in advanced imaging systems, like MRI or CT scanners, under tight time constraints to minimize equipment downtime. They must also stay up-to-date with rapidly evolving technology and adhere to strict safety and compliance standards. Collaboration with clinical staff and vendors is essential for accurate problem diagnosis and timely repairs. Adaptability and strong communication skills are key to successfully handling these multifaceted tasks.

What is the difference between Imaging Service Engineer vs Medical Equipment Technician?

AspectImaging Service EngineerMedical Equipment Technician
CredentialsTypically requires certifications like CBET or manufacturer-specific trainingOften requires certifications such as Certified Biomedical Equipment Technician (CBET)
Work EnvironmentHospitals, imaging centers, medical device companiesHospitals, clinics, healthcare facilities
Employer & IndustryMedical imaging manufacturers, healthcare providersHealthcare facilities, biomedical service companies
Job FocusInstallation, maintenance, repair of imaging equipment like MRI, CT scannersMaintenance, troubleshooting, repair of various medical devices

Both roles involve maintaining medical equipment, but Imaging Service Engineers primarily focus on advanced imaging systems like MRI and CT scanners, requiring specialized technical skills and certifications. Medical Equipment Technicians handle a broader range of medical devices, often with different certification requirements. The choice depends on your specific interests in imaging technology versus general medical device maintenance.

What is an imaging service engineer?

An Imaging Service Engineer is a specialized technician responsible for installing, maintaining, and repairing medical imaging equipment such as MRI machines, CT scanners, X-ray systems, and ultrasound devices. They ensure that this critical equipment operates safely and efficiently, often working in hospitals, clinics, or for equipment manufacturers. Their role may involve troubleshooting complex issues, performing routine maintenance, calibrating machines, and training healthcare staff on proper equipment use. Imaging Service Engineers play a vital part in maintaining the quality and safety of medical imaging services.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an imaging service engineer?

To thrive as an Imaging Service Engineer, you need a strong background in electronics, biomedical engineering, or a related field, often supported by an associate or bachelor's degree. Familiarity with diagnostic imaging equipment (like MRI, CT, or X-ray machines), manufacturer-specific certifications, and experience using service management software are typically required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, customer service orientation, and effective communication help you excel in troubleshooting and working with clinical staff. These skills are crucial to ensure the safe, reliable operation of medical imaging equipment, directly impacting patient care and clinical efficiency.
